The Hengst 110LEN0400-2X/PWR10B00-V2,2-M-R6 (1020938B) is a hydraulic inline filter designed for the filtration of solids from fluids within hydraulic and lubricating oil systems. This product is intended for installation in pipelines and features a robust design class as a single inline filter. The filter material configuration utilizes PWR10, a multilayer glass fiber material, which provides effective filtration with a grade of 10. It is equipped with an NBR seal and features an aluminum housing, ensuring durability under various conditions. The nominal size of this filter is 0400, and it supports a port designation of G1 1/2 in a horizontal position, conforming to ISO228-1 standards. The maximum working pressure and nominal pressure are both rated at 110 bar, making it suitable for high-pressure applications. Additionally, this filter has been tested to withstand a collapse pressure rating of 330 bar. Featuring an optical indicator with a switching point at 2.2 bar, the Hengst filter allows for easy monitoring of its operational status without the need for electronic systems. Although it does not include a check valve or lid lifting device, its cyclone effect enhances the separation efficiency within the system. The Hengst 110LEN0400-2X/PWR10B00-V2,2-M-R6 is compatible with HFC and HFA fluids as per DIN24550 standards and includes standard support cage material for added reliability during operation.
